Our Team:
The Maine Mariners are a proud member of the ECHL, the premier AA professional hockey league in North America and a key development pipeline to the National Hockey League. As the ECHL affiliate of the Boston Bruins, the organization benefits from a strong and collaborative relationship with one of hockey’s most historic and successful franchises. The organization is committed to delivering a first-class sports and entertainment experience while serving as a central pillar of the Portland community.
The Mariners have built strong momentum in recent seasons, establishing a winning culture throughout the organization and advancing to the second round of the Kelly Cup Playoffs, while also driving significant growth in attendance, ticket sales, corporate partnerships, and overall revenue. This combination of on-ice success and business performance positions the club for continued growth and long-term success.
